Supporting Alzheimer’s Society by cycling up to 120 miles in charity cycle ride

Our keen colleague cyclists have been busy fundraising for Alzheimer’s Society South West by cycling en masse across Devon.
LiveWest Charity Cycle Ride Group

On Friday 12 July three teams set out from our head office in Skypark Exeter.

The difficult routes included a 120 mile circum-navigation of Dartmoor, a shorter 65 mile route over the moor, and a 30 mile ride along the cycle paths of East Devon. The challenge has raised over £3,500 so far.

Andy Hart Director of Corporate Finance at LiveWest, said: “We are delighted to be raising money for our charity of the year which is the largest and most influential dementia charity in the UK. We promote a cycle scheme to staff and encourage cycling to work, so we're pleased that the challenge attracted both experienced and new riders. We were so proud to have achieved such distances.”

The South West has the highest number of people living with dementia in the West, however, it also has the lowest diagnosis rate.

Alzheimer’s Society provides local support for families living with dementia across the South West, including activity groups, Memory Cafes, Singing for the Brain groups and a Dementia Support service.

They also provide telephone support and advice, campaign for better dementia care and fund vital research into both cure and care, some of which is taking place at the University of Exeter

Claire Frost, Community Fundraiser for Alzheimer’s Society in Devon, Cornwall, and the Isles of Scilly said: “Dementia is the UK’s biggest killer – someone develops dementia every three minutes, with one million expected to develop the condition by 2021. We are hugely grateful that LiveWest is rising to the huge challenge it poses by uniting with Alzheimer’s Society throughout 2019 and organising this fantastic cycle ride as part of their fundraising. Sadly, dementia devastates lives, but every pound raised by the LiveWest team will help Alzheimer’s Society provide vital information and support, improve care, fund research and create lasting change for people affected by the condition.”
